QUESTION:
Peut-on modifier le temps de surveillance du cycle d'un S7-200
?
REPONSE:
Le temps de surveillance du cycle est défini à environ 500ms.
L'opération " WDR" vous permet de remettre à zéro le temps
de surveillance et donc de le relancer. Cela vous permet d'éviter
une erreur de temps de cycle qui apparaît lors du dépassement du
temps de cycle.
Attention: L'opération "WDR" redémarre le temps de
surveillance de la CPU. Chaque module de sorties TOR dispose
également d'une surveillance de cycle qui n'est pas
redémarrée avec l'instruction "WDR". Cette surveillance de cycle
des E/S permet de désactiver les sorties TOR lorsque la CPU ne
communique pas pendant un certain temps avec le module. Le temps de
cycle du module est défini de telle sorte qu'il soit supérieur au
temps de surveillance de la CPU.
Si l'opération "WDR" est indispensable dans un long programme,
insérez également une opération d'écriture directe dans un octet de
sortie TOR de chaque module d'extension afin de réinitialiser la
surveillance du temps de cycle de chaque module d'extension. Cette
fonction n'a aucune influence sur les modules d'entrées TOR,
analogiques et PROFIBUS DP.
Notez également que le redémarrage de la surveillance du temps
de cycle par l'opération "WDR" allonge le cycle de la CPU. Les
actions réalisées en fin de cycle sont influencées. Cela signifie
que, par exemple, la lecture d'entrées ou l'écriture de sorties ne
se fait qu'à la fin du cycle. Vous trouverez une liste des actions
concernées dans le manuel système du S7-200 à l'article ID :
1109582.
Mots-clefs: Temps de cycle
|